Since
commit d61d29cf16
Introduce a basic client for the language server protocol
extra proprosals were requested in the fragile case on a change
notification, e.g. for function signature completion. Restrict this to
the language client proposal, as it was actually intended.
The language client does not support prefixes, so introduce this concept
for deciding whether to request new proposals or not.

This is a re-work of our completion engine. Primary goals are:
- Allow the computation to run in a separate thread so the GUI is not locked.
- Support a model-based approach. QStrings are still needed (filtering, etc), but
internal structures are free to use more efficient representations.
- Unifiy all kinds of *assist* into a more reusable and extensible framework.
- Remove unnecessary dependencies on the text editor so we have more generic
and easily "plugable" components (still things to be resolved).
